我了解AWS Step Functions支持AWS Lambda Functions的自定义错误处理,但是活动工作者(sendTaskFailure)是否支持自定义错误?
谢谢
答案 0 :(得分:0)
是的,有!无论活动工作者是什么,您都可以为自己的步骤定义Catch
属性,以处理不同的自定义错误,请参见Amazon States Language Errors和Handling Error Conditions Using a State Machine。
您只需要在SendTaskFailure name
属性中正确设置错误名称,请参阅SendTaskFailure,并在不同的Catch
语句/案例中使用这些名称。